A gentle story about friendship, change, and learning how to say goodbye. In a peaceful grove, two young trees grow up together, an oak and an apple tree who share laughter, sway in the wind, and spend their days side by side. Life feels simple and certain. Until one day the apple tree shares difficult news. She must move to a nearby orchard where there is more sunlight so she can grow stronger. For the oak, the news feels sudden and unfair. The idea of her best friend leaving is something she never imagined. As the days pass, the two friends try to enjoy the time they have left. They laugh, dance in the breeze, and pretend everything is normal, even when it is not. When the day finally comes to say goodbye, the oak is left standing in the same place, but the grove feels very different. The Tree That Missed Her Friend gently explores the feelings that follow a separation. The oak remembers the good moments with her friend but struggles with the quiet emptiness left behind. The story allows children to see that sadness is natural and that missing someone is a normal part of caring. Then something unexpected happens. A deer appears carrying an apple, a gift from the apple tree now growing safely in the orchard. The small message brings comfort and reassurance. She is okay. She still remembers. Soon the deer becomes a messenger between the two trees, carrying apples and small updates back and forth. The oak still misses her friend, but warmth slowly returns to the grove. Over time, a new friendship begins to grow. This thoughtful story helps children understand: ¿ Feelings of loss and separation ¿ The importance of staying connected ¿ That sadness and happiness can exist together ¿ How new friendships can grow after change Perfect for bedtime reading, classrooms, and families navigating moves or changes, The Tree That Missed Her Friend reminds readers that even when someone goes far away, the bonds of friendship can remain strong. And sometimes that friendship arrives in the simplest way, an apple carried carefully by a deer, right when it is needed most.
